Closeouts. Mammut's Cerro Torre waterproof jacket is made using Schoeller® WB400 soft shell fabric that stretches easily, retains its shape, breathes well and blocks snow, wind, rain, stains and dirt.
  • Exterior resists snags, tears and abrasion
  • Stand-up collar with soft microfleece lining
  • Zip hand and Napoleon pockets
  • Length: 28-½”
  • Weight: 2 lb. 8 oz.
  • Fabric: 44% nylon, 38% polyester, 11% polyurethane, 7% spandex
  • Care: Machine wash, hang dry
  • Closeouts. China or Turkey, may not specify.
  • Color (60) is 49% polyester, 31% nylon, 14% polyurethant, 6% spandex.
  • Size: XS(32-34) S(35-36) M(37-39) L(40-41) XL(42-43) 2XL(44-46)

    I first saw the Cerro Torre worn by our canyoning guide in Switzerland and had to find one for myself when I got back. I won an auction for one 5 years ago off the big online bidding site. It was AWESOME, my favorite jacket. Recently the zipper broke and so I thought I was due for a new one. I bought this newer model and was sadly disappointed. It fit too baggy, didn't stay in place while moving body and arms, didn't have the thumb holes in the sleeves for keeping the jacket in place and was tough and itchy. I ended up returning it. I am just going to fix my old one. Still a great jacket, but I had higher expectations given my satisfaction with the older model.
